For those who refuse to stop at the pavement's end, the venerable electric-start XR650L can extend your motorcycle adventure to roads less traveled be they dirt roads, trails or forgotten byways in proven dual-sport style. With it's bulletproof 644cc SOHC engine and 5 speed transmission produces power and torque ideally suited for both on-road and off-road riding.Perfect motorcycle for the Lake or the Beach, or for the RV!Other Features:* Free-flowing, two-into-one exhaust system with quiet, spark arrester/muffler.* Reliable electric starter system* Pro-Link Rear Suspension* Motocross-style seat

Honda is recalling over 20,000 Shadows in the US

Fri, 29 Jan 2016

Honda is recalling 22,142 motorcycles from shipments produced between 2010 and 2016. The reason was the vibration from the engine, which over time leads to chafing of the fall sensor wire in the common harness. Dealers promise to move the wire to another location and replace the sensor free of charge.

Florida to Alaska and Back on a Honda CBR125R

Tue, 24 May 2011

A 65-year-old man from Windsor, Ontario, Canada is attempting a cross-continent ride from Key West, Fla., to Prudhoe Bay, Alaska and back, on a Honda CBR125R. Bob Munden of Windsor is attempting to set the record for the smallest motorcycle to make the trip from the southernmost accessible point in North America to the northernmost point, and back. A print shop owner with a stable of five motorcycles, Munden will attempt the trip on the 124.7cc single-cylinder four-stroke Honda CBR125R, an entry-level sportbike model Honda offers in Canada.
